Kenwood Towne Centre

Kenwood Towne Centre is a large shopping mall located in the northern suburbs of Cincinnati. It features over 150 stores, including department stores like Nordstrom and Dillard’s, as well as popular retailers like H&M, American Eagle, and Sephora. The mall also features a variety of dining options, including sit-down restaurants and fast food options, as well as a food court. Additionally, Kenwood Towne Centre offers a variety of services such as a children’s play area, currency exchange, and a salon.

Rookwood Commons

Rookwood Commons is an outdoor shopping center located in the eastern suburbs of Cincinnati. It features a variety of retailers such as Anthropologie, Williams-Sonoma, and Lululemon, as well as several popular restaurants and cafes. This shopping center is known for its open-air atmosphere and the beautiful landscape that surrounds it. Rookwood commons also features a variety of services such as free Wi-Fi, and a playground for children.

The Banks

The Banks is a mixed-use development located in downtown Cincinnati, that offers a variety of shopping, dining, and entertainment options. It features a variety of retailers such as The Buckle, Chico’s, and Lululemon, as well as several popular restaurants such as The Cheesecake Factory and The Yard House. The Banks also offers a variety of services such as free Wi-Fi, and a playground for children.

Findlay Market

Findlay Market is Cincinnati’s oldest continuously operated public market, located in the Over-the-Rhine neighborhood. The market features a variety of vendors selling fresh produce, meats, cheeses, and other goods, as well as a variety of specialty shops and boutiques. It’s a great destination for those looking to shop for local goods and experiencing the local culture. The market also features a variety of dining options, including food trucks and sit-down restaurants.

The Shops at Liberty Center

The Shops at Liberty Center is an open-air shopping center located in Liberty Township, Ohio. It features a variety of retailers such as Victoria’s Secret, H&M, and J. Crew, as well as a variety of dining options and a movie theater. The center has a modern and sleek design that makes it a great destination for a day of shopping and entertainment. The Shops at Liberty Center also offers free Wi-Fi and a children’s play area.
